F.A.Q. Команды Linux Enigma2

Yarik

Команда форума

Yarik

Администратор
Команда форума
Регистрация
17 Ноя 2022
Темы
66
Сообщения
2.734
Реакции
9.774
Баллы
163
(Ант)спут
(Triax TD88) 4.8E-90E
Тюнер
Amiko SHD-8900 Alien
IPTV
Ugoos X3 Pro
Ugoos X4Q Extra
ПМЖ
satfan.info
Самые нужные и часто используемые команды
Код:
init 4
Перевод ресивера в режим с остановкой Enigma
Код:
init 3
Перевод ресивера в режим с работающей Enigma
Код:
init 0
Выключение ресивера
Код:
init 6
Перезагрузка ресивера
Код:
shutdown -r now
Такая же команда как и init 6
Код:
shutdown -h now
Полное выключение
Код:
reboot
Перезапуск ресивера
Код:
wget -q -O - http://127.0.0.1/web/powerstate?newstate=0
Перевод ресивера в режим ожидания. Эта же команда выводит его из него
Код:
shutdown -h hours:minutes &
Запланировать остановку системы в указанное время
Код:
shutdown -c
Отменить запланированную по расписанию остановку системы

Информация об устройстве
Код:
hostname
Имя системы (hostname)
Код:
cat /proc/cpuinfo
Инфо о модели процессора
Код:
uname -m
Отобразить архитектуру процессора
Код:
cat /proc/version
Версия Linux kernel
Код:
uname -a
Версия ядра
Код:
opkg list | grep modules
Версия драйверов
Код:
lsmod
Информация о подключенных модулях ядра (Работающих драйверах)
Код:
cat /proc/meminfo
Информация о памяти
Код:
cat /proc/swaps
Показать файл(ы) подкачки
Код:
grep MemTotal /proc/meminfo
Информация о RAM
Код:
cat /proc/mtd
Определение разделов в шестнадцатеричном формате
Код:
cat /proc/partitions
Разделы внутренней флешь-памяти
Код:
cat /proc/mounts
Смонтированые пути
Код:
cat /proc/net/dev
Показать сетевые интерфейсы и статистику по ним
Код:
ifconfig
Данные настройки и статистика сетевой карты ресивера
Код:
lsusb -tv
Показать в виде дерева USB устройства
Код:
dmesg
Обнаруженные устройства и сообщения, выводимые при загрузке
Код:
ip link show
Отобразить состояние всех интерфейсов
Код:
ethtool eth0
Отобразить статистику интерфейса eth0 с выводом такой информации, как поддерживаемые и текущие режимы соединения
Код:
netstat -tupn
Отобразить все установленные сетевые соединения по протоколам TCP и UDP без разрешения имён в IP-адреса и PID'ы и имена процессов, обеспечивающих эти соединения
Код:
netstat -tupln
Отобразить все сетевые соединения по протоколам TCP и UDP без разрешения имён в IP-адреса и PID'ы и имена процессов, слушающих порты
Код:
date
Вывести системную дату

Изменение настроек системы
Код:
opkg update && opkg list-upgradable
Позволяет проверить то, что доступно в обновлении на имидж
Код:
mount -o rw,remount /boot
Переподключение папки /boot в режим чтения-записи (Для замены бутлого)
Код:
passwd root
Можно просто passwd - смена пароля, доступ к FTP, Telnet и т.д.
Код:
date 041217002007.00*
Установить системные дату и время ММДДЧЧммГГГГ.СС (МесяцДеньЧасМинутыГод.Секунды)

Мониторинг и отладка
Код:
ps
Видим запущенные процессы
Код:
top
Отобразить запущенные процессы, используемые ими ресурсы и другую полезную информацию (С автоматическим обновлением данных)
Код:
df -h
Отображает информацию о смонтированных разделах с отображением общего, доступного и используемого пространства файловой системы, а также на дисках
Код:
setconsole
Вывод в консоль всех действий, производимых с пульта и передней панели ресивера
Код:
du / -xh > /tmp/usage.log
Вывод информации в файл об использовании внутренней памяти ресивера с детализацией размеров файлов

Инсталляция, установка, перезапись
Код:
opkg -force-overwrite install enigma2-fonts
Принудительно перезаписать шрифты
Код:
init 4 && opkg update && opkg upgrade && init 6
Запуск обновления имиджа командой из telnet

Или ещё как вариант, поочерёдно дать команды для обновления:
Код:
opkg update
opkg upgrade
opkg download
Позволяет скачивать плагины напрямую из имиджа, владеть каналом фида, устанавливать *.ipk в /home/root/, директорию Вашего приемника для безопасного хранения и т.д.

Пару примеров, как следует выполнять команды
Код:
opkg download enigma2-plugin-systemplugins-hdmicec
opkg download enigma2-plugin-systemplugins-autobouquetsmaker
Код:
opkg install
Позволяет установить плагины непосредственно с фида имиджа, ниже несколько примеров
Код:
opkg install python-gdata
Или ещё как вариант
Код:
opkg update && opkg install python-gdata
Код:
opkg list *sqlite3*
Если известна только часть имени, в данном случае sqlite3

Код:
opkg update && opkg install enigma2-src
Скачать исходники с имиджа OpenPLI
Код:
opkg install -force-overwrite enigma2-src

Код:
opkg install /tmp/enigma2-plugin-systemplugins-fansetup_3.1-rc2_mipsel.ipk
Команда для установки *.ipk пакета (enigma2-plugin-systemplugins-fansetup_3.1-rc2_mipsel.ipk)
Код:
opkg install /tmp/enigma2-plugin-systemplugins-fansetup_3.1-rc2_mipsel.ipk --force-overwrite
Так если не будет ставится, устанавливаем перезаписью с ключём --force-overwrite
Код:
opkg install /tmp/*.ipk
Для установки всех *.ipk из директории /tmp
Код:
opkg install /tmp/*.ipk --nodeps
Для установки всех *.ipk из директории /tmp без зависимостей
Код:
tar xzvpf /tmp/vtipanel_icons_ru.tar.gz  -C /
Установка tar.gz линукс архива, в примере архив vtipanel_icons_ru.tar.gz
Как снять лог работы плагина
Перед выполнением следующих комманд сделайте рестарт Enigma, чтоб все Ваши последние изменения настроек сохранились на флеш память
Чтобы посмотреть лог работы нужно через телнет дать команду:
Код:
init 4
Enigma остановится. Потом дать команду:
Код:
enigma2 2>&1 |tee /tmp/e2.log
Enigma заново запустится, а лог работы будет писаться одновременно и в файл и в telnet
Нужно запустить плагин произвести действия, которые приводят к ошибке подождать немного. Лог получим здесь: /tmp/e2.log

Во вложении для удобства они же (и не только) в виде документов в форматах *.odt и *.rtf
 

Вложения

    rar

    Linux.rar

    Размер: 168.4 KB
    Просмотры: 24
    Дата:
Последнее редактирование:
enigma 2 на тв тюнере без подключения к интернету откуда берет время ?
После включения тв тюнера на табло было неправильное время,
потом стало правильным.
 
Последнее редактирование:
enigma 2 на тв тюнере без подключения к интернету откуда берет время ?
После включения тв тюнера на табло было неправильное время,
потом стало правильным.
Со спутника.
 
Назад
Сверху Снизу